    a few things investigators will look at:

    *the collision appears to have happened at around 300ft altitude
    *I have read the helicopters in DC airspace are restricted to below 100ft
    *if accurate, the helo should not have been that high
    *helo was flying with visual flight rules
    *helo had night vision goggles on board
    *visibility was "good" (clear skies)
    *one post I saw suggested the helo flew into the CRJ from behind
    *
    not sure how that's confirmed, but if accurate, could explain why the helo pilot did not see the CRJ's landing lights
    *moments before the collision, the Helo pilot confirmed he could see the CRJ
    *however, there was another CRJ taking off, in the same vicinity, it's possible that's the plane he saw

    so many questions, but the altitude question seems particularly pertinent, atm

    Sixty-seven people are feared dead after an American Airlines jet collided with a U.S. Army helicopter and crashed into the Potomac River.

    https://www.cnn.com/us/live-news/pl...ington-dc-01-29-25/index.html?t=1738206614132

    A passenger jet carrying 64 people crashed into the Potomac River near Washington, D.C., after colliding midair with a military helicopter on a training flight while approaching Ronald Reagan Washington National Airport on Wednesday night.

    The plane was being operated as American Eagle Flight 5342 by PSA Airlines for its parent carrier, American Airlines, and had taken off from Wichita, Kan., with 60 passengers and four crew members onboard. At about 9 p.m., it collided with a U.S. Army helicopter carrying a crew of three.

    Early on Thursday, officials said they believed that no one had survived the collision. Rescue teams, including boats and divers, had searched the dark, frigid water overnight.
